Get into Art: Places by Susie Brooks features famous pieces of art that depict scenes like serene landscapes, snowy mountains, and busy streets and waterways. From artists such as Van Gogh, Canaletto, Klee and Hokusai, each work is paired with a related art project perfect for young artist's hands. A gorgeous art series that explores a wide range of artists' work while encouraging children to develop their own skills and techniques, Get into Art! is perfect for active young artists of all abilities. Each book features twelve artworks, with information about the work and the artist. Art activities are varied, intriguing, clearly explained and will act as a springboard for plenty of artistic experiments.
